Methods
RequestStateChange
Method overview
This method is used to control all the tasks associated to the task group.
This method shall return:
•
0 "Completed with No Error" when the transition can be accomplished within the internal timeout
period
•
2 "Unknown/UnSpecified Error"
•
3 "Can not complete within Time-out Period"
•
5 "Invalid Parameters" when RequestedState is not 2 "Start", 3 "Suspend", nor 4 "Terminate"
•
4096 "Method Parameters Checked - Transition Started"
•
4097 "Invalid State Transition" when the requested to state is invalid.
•
4099 "Busy" when the a previously requested transition is underway.
•
A standard error message containing the meaning of the ErrorInfo returned from the method if an
error is returned.

HPSVSP_SyncMirrorConcreteJob : CIM_ConcreteJob
Class introduction
This class represents a sync mirror task created as a result of:
•
A client invoking a method on this server/agent
•
The server/agent invoking a method on itself
This class represents the sync mirror task. The affected task elements are elements on which the task
is acting.
EnumerateInstances:
•
Produce the list of sync mirror jobs.
GetInstance:
•
Fetch the task.
DeleteInstance:
•
Delete the instance.
